Interview: Advertisements Coming to CS
Source: CS-Nation
__________ In-game advertisements are coming to Counter-Strike 1.6. Go ahead and let that sink in a bit. CS-Nation has the exclusive first interview with Valve's Doug Lombardi about this upcoming addition into the Counter-Strike world. Last edited by Iria; Dec 9, 2006 at 07:15 PM. |
